LC Connector Specifications: Key Features and Standards
LC connector specifications define the rigorous standards that ensure compatibility and performance in fiber optic systems. These connectors adhere to the IEC 61754-20 standard, featuring a 1.25mm ceramic ferrule that provides low insertion loss, typically under 0.2 dB, and high return loss exceeding 50 dB for single-mode applications. The push-pull latching mechanism allows for quick and secure mating, with a maximum of 500 insertion cycles before degradation.
Durability is a hallmark of LC connector specifications, with the connector body often constructed from high-grade plastic or metal alloys to withstand environmental stresses like temperature fluctuations from -40°C to 75°C. Color-coding on the housing—such as blue for single-mode and aqua for multimode—facilitates easy identification during installation. Beyond basic metrics, LC connector specifications include precise alignment tolerances of ±0.1mm for the ferrule, minimizing signal attenuation. They support duplex configurations, allowing simultaneous transmission and reception over dual fibers, which is essential for bidirectional communication protocols. Compliance with Telcordia GR-326-CORE standards further validates their robustness against mechanical and optical stresses, making them ideal for long-term deployments.
LC Connector Applications: Versatility Across Industries
LC connector applications span a wide array of sectors, from telecommunications to enterprise networking, where high-density connectivity is paramount. In data centers, LC connectors facilitate the interconnection of switches, servers, and storage systems, enabling 10Gbps to 400Gbps Ethernet speeds with minimal footprint. Their compact design allows for higher port densities in patch panels, optimizing space in crowded server rooms.
In telecommunications, LC connector applications are crucial for FTTH (Fiber to the Home) deployments, connecting optical network terminals to central offices with low-loss performance. They are also prevalent in CATV systems, supporting video distribution over fiber with stable signal quality. For industrial settings, such as manufacturing automation or process control, these connectors provide rugged interfaces for harsh environments, often with armored cable variants to resist mechanical damage.

In medical and military applications, the precision of LC connectors ensures secure data links for imaging equipment or secure communications, where reliability can be mission-critical. Emerging uses in 5G infrastructure and IoT networks further highlight their adaptability, as they handle increasing bandwidth demands without compromising on size or performance.
Additionally, LC connector applications extend to testing and measurement equipment, where they interface with optical power meters and OTDRs for network diagnostics. This versatility underscores their role in enabling scalable, future-proof networks across residential, commercial, and industrial landscapes.
LC Connector Dimensions: Precision in a Compact Package
LC connector dimensions are engineered for minimalism, measuring just 4.5mm in width and 5.25mm in height for the duplex housing, which is half the size of SC connectors. This small footprint allows for up to 72 fibers in a single rack unit, revolutionizing high-density cabling. The ferrule diameter of 1.25mm ensures precise core alignment, critical for maintaining optical performance in multimode or single-mode fibers.
Detailed LC connector dimensions include a coupling nut length of approximately 8mm and an overall connector length of 50mm when including the boot, facilitating easy handling during field terminations. The latching tab extends 2mm, providing secure engagement without excessive force. These measurements are standardized to ensure interoperability across vendors, with tolerances as tight as 0.01mm for ferrule geometry to prevent end-face damage.

Variations like uniboot designs reduce cable clutter by combining duplex fibers into a single jacket, further optimizing dimensions for clean installations. For angled physical contact (APC) versions, the ferrule polish angle of 8 degrees enhances return loss, all while maintaining the core dimensional profile.
Understanding LC connector dimensions is essential for system designers planning cable management and airflow in equipment racks. Their compatibility with MPO/MTP adapters allows for fan-out configurations, expanding applications in parallel optics for 40G/100G networks. This dimensional efficiency not only saves space but also reduces material costs, making LC connectors a cost-effective choice for scalable deployments.
